Detailed Specs & Features

According to the specs, this cabin luggage measures 22 inches in size and weighs just 3 kilograms, offering a pleasantly light option for overhead storage. Its weight and storage volume of 40 liters, expandable by up to 10%, give travelers a decent capacity for essentials without burdening them. Thanks to a thoughtfully designed weight distribution balance system, the load remains comfortable to handle despite the softcase frame constructed largely from polyester and plastic materials. The bag's softshell characteristic with medium shock absorption and abrasion resistance speaks to its intended moderate travel durability rather than rugged use. Mobility is well addressed with four spinner wheels made of plastic, each roughly 1.97 inches in diameter, offering high maneuverability with 360° rotation. Although these wheels lack shock-dampening properties and noisiness rates medium, the integrated wheel housing protection aims to preserve wheel integrity over time. The telescopic handle, crafted from aluminum with a height of 21 inches and a push-button locking mechanism, supports smooth handling. The locking system is simple and functional, but does not include TSA compatibility, meaning security checks may require manual unlocking.

User Experience & Performance (Based on Specs)

Design & Build

In daily use, the bag's soft polyester outer and inner lining combine for a feel that's light without sacrificing a medium level of protection against scrapes and shocks. The single-needle stitching and medium stitch density maintain structural integrity without adding weight. Corner rubbers and base reinforcement lend added durability where abrasion could otherwise wear down material. Given its medium tear resistance and relatively flexible frame, it's clear it's optimized for gentle handling rather than heavy-duty or highly abusive use cases. Performance

Performance-wise, the weather and environmental resistance of the 5 Cities bag is modest. With a low level of water resistance and no waterproof zippers or significant dust protection, users should be mindful not to expose it extensively to harsh elements. Drop resistance rates medium, but impact and crush resistance are lower, reflecting the softcase design philosophy prioritizing lightness over heavy-duty ruggedness. Its self-standing ability and high maneuverability offset some of these physical limitations, enhancing convenience when navigating busy airports or urban environments. Compartments & Organization

Storage organization caters to straightforward packing. The open main compartment with a removable divider and compression straps offers adaptability in packing style, while a quick-access external pocket supports easy retrieval of essentials. Notably, the luggage includes a key holder inside, which adds a subtle but practical security detail often missing in basic carry-ons. However, it lacks specialized compartments like garment bags, shoe compartments, or tech organizer pockets, which reflects its targeted use for compact short trips rather than more extensive travel gear organization. Extra Features

While it does come equipped with an easy-lift handle design and moderate maintenance ease rated high, the absence of cutoff features such as TSA locks, USB charging ports, or luggage trackers positions this bag as a no-frills, budget-conscious choice. The warranty, boasting a limited lifetime coverage, does provide some confidence toward long-term ownership, even if repairability and spare parts availability rank low.
